jiangq created THRIFT-3857: ------------------------------ Summary: thrift js:node complier support an object as parameter not an instance of struct Key: THRIFT-3857 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/THRIFT-3857 Project: Thrift Issue Type: New Feature Components: Node.js - Compiler Affects Versions: 0.9.3, 1.0 Reporter: jiangq
use the tutorial.thrift,code like: {code:javascript} let param = { op: ttypes.Operation.DIVIDE, num1: 1, num2: 0 } let work = new ttypes.Work(param); client.calculate(1, work) .then(function(message) { console.log('Whoa? You know how to divide by zero?'); }) .fail(function(err) { console.log("InvalidOperation " + err); }); {code} can we support like these: {code:javascript} let work = { op: ttypes.Operation.DIVIDE, num1: 1, num2: 0 } client.calculate(1, work) .then(function(message) { console.log('Whoa? You know how to divide by zero?'); }) .fail(function(err) { console.log("InvalidOperation " + err); }); {code} If you can support this feature will be very convenient, and I have read the 't_js_generator.cc' file, find this feature is easy to support, can you add the support for this feature -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v6.3.4#6332)
